I also cannot recall a system of any sort I have run across that does not support long filenames which means it is FAT32 or some 32-bit OS... I would think for an ebook reader FAT32 is a MUST support sorta thing. Without it the OS will need to maintain a dedicated database that maps filenames longer than the 8.3 format to an 8.3 filename...might as well use FAT32 if they are going to that much trouble. BTW, this is essentially what the special driver for MSDOS under Win95 did, even so, it was messy at best. |
